Client Service Manager, Retirement Services
American Trust Retirement is seeking a Client Service Manager to deliver high-quality account management for a portfolio of defined contribution relationships. The role focuses on client satisfaction, retention, and operational efficiency while resolving client issues and providing retirement plan expertise.

Responsibilities
Build strong relationships with clients and advisors through proactive communication
Maintain and enhance relationships with clients, financial advisors, and industry partners by providing engaging on-going service; serve as the primary point of contact for all assigned clients, financial advisors, and partners, on the day-to-day account management with operational oversight of all account related activities
The Client Service Manager may work with the Relationship Managers to deliver client satisfaction by providing retirement plan and operational expertise, proactively identifying, owning and resolving client issues and engaging clients with value added consulting
Support clients in managing their fiduciary responsibilities by addressing and resolving plan compliance, regulatory and operational issues in conjunction with the third- party administrator (“TPA”) and financial advisor, if applicable
Ensure that our commitments to our clients are met by proactively reviewing the status of assigned plans’ periodic activity (compliance testing, 5500, quarterly statements, RMDs, etc.)
Coordinate effectively and efficiently with internal operations partners, financial advisors, and other client related service providers
Adhere to team individual service and retention goals
Responsible for the overall client relationship experience, including building and maintaining a strong relationship with plan sponsors, advisors, and TPAs
Analyze, troubleshoot, and problem solve plan administration and recordkeeping issues
Provide training to Advisors, and Plan Sponsors, to communicate procedures relating to payroll submission, fund changes, loan and distribution processing, compliance testing, etc
Advise Plan Sponsors on mandatory and discretionary plan document amendments
Understand non-discrimination testing under sections 401(k), 401(m) and 401(a)(4) of Internal Revenue Code
Provide assistance and website training to Advisors, Plan Sponsors, and TPAs
Solves diverse and complex problems using solid analytical skills where limited precedents or guidelines exist
Able to understand process flow and their interdependencies
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's degree or an equivalent combination of education and relevant experience
Knowledge of ERISA Regulations and the applicable Internal Revenue Code is required
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Excel and Outlook is required
Must have strong written and verbal communication skills
Capable to relate the customer needs to other team members and leadership
Must have the ability to process detailed work within assigned timeframes and without errors
Familiarity with various plan designs (traditional 401(k), safe harbor, automatic contribution arrangements, new comparability, etc.)
Demonstrated experience handling relationships with participants, advisors, Plan Sponsors, or TPAs
Preferred
Professional certification preferred ASPPA (QKA, QPA), CEBS or NIPA (APA) (APR) preferred
SunGard Relius Administration experience preferred
Compliance testing and contribution calculation experience preferred
